Tranz is from the Gorillaz’ sixth studio album, originally released in June 2018 and then released with a music video in September 2018. One of the interesting features of the music video for Tranz is that Murdoc is replaced by Ace as Murdoc is in prison. Noodle sports a different look in this music video too, opting for a lighter hair colour.
This piano arrangement of Tranz is of moderate difficulty and would be appropriate for intermediate level pianists to learn. Many of the patterns are easy to learn, so get started!

The theme song to Spider-Man was written by Paul Francis and Bob Harris. It uses 12-part vocals and a fun and groovy backing band. The Spider-Man theme song is very popular and has been covered by several artists, including The Ramones, Michael Buble and has also been parodied in The Simpsons Movie.
This piano arrangement of the Spider-Man theme song is perfect for upper intermediate to advanced level pianists who want something fast, exciting and jazzy to play at their next recital. It is such a well-known theme that it is guaranteed to be a hit every time!

Ambiguous is the opening song to Kill La Kill Season 2, replacing Sirius as the opening song. It is performed by GARNiDELiA and written by meg rock and toku. The Kill la Kill OP 2 is a driving and groovy track with catchy melodies throughout. It is a challenging but rewarding piece to play on piano and would be a great choice to perform at a recital, or for personal enjoyment.

Who’s Afraid of the Big Bad Wolf is a song by Frank Churchill with lyrics bye Ann Ronell. It was originally used in Three Little Pigs (1933, Disney) sung by the two little pigs who built their houses of straw and twigs. It became a huge hit in the 1930s and its longevity has made it one of Disney’s most well-known songs until this day.
This piano arrangement of Who’s Afraid of the Big Bad Wolf is for upper intermediate to advanced level pianists who want to play something fun and recognisable! Enjoy!
